    Abstract: A process for producing furfural and levulinic acid from lignocellulose-comprising biomass is disclosed. The biomass is slurried using water and optionally an acid, subjected to hydrolysis, and then subjected to a solid/liquid separation to yield at least an aqueous fraction comprising C5 and C6 sugars and a solid fraction comprising cellulose and lignin. Furfural is obtained by adding an organic solvent to the aqueous fraction, heating at 120-220° C. for a sufficient time to form furfural, cooling, and separating an organic phase comprising at least part of the furfural from an aqueous phase. Levulinic acid is obtained by suspending the solid fraction in water and optionally an acid, heating the suspension to 140-220° C., and separating an aqueous fraction comprising the levulinic acid from a solid fraction.
